Job Description

The Technician Neuropsychology reflects the mission vision and values of NM adheres to the organizations Code of Ethics and Corporate Compliance Program and complies with all relevant policies procedures guidelines and all other regulatory and accreditation standards.

The Technician Neuropsychology under the supervision of a clinical neuropsychologist administers and scores psychological and neuropsychological tests for patients in an accurate valid and standardized manner to aid in the diagnosis prognosis treatment and follow up of patients with various neurological health conditions.

Responsibilities:

  • Obtains preapproval for insurance coverage (provides information conducts followup) by communicating with patients insurer. Communicates any obstacles so patient may be notified.
  • Prepares testing instruments/supplies.
  • Administers tests and performs other related procedures as directed by neuropsychologist.
  • Conducts detailed behavioral observations and reports to neuropsychologist obtains  direction for subsequent procedures.
  • Scores neuropsychological tests identifies appropriate normative values translates scores makes recommendations and coordinates treatment prepares reports of behavioral observations and score levels for assistance in diagnosis.
  • Coordinates with team to ensure that test supplies are adequate and up to date.
  • May per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ications :

Required:

  • BA degree in Clinical Psychology or related field from an accredited college or university.
  • Minimum of one year experience in a relevant role.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of principal assessment/treatment of patients with neuropsychological disorders.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of principal testing instruments scoring/administration translation of scores.

Preferred:

  •  Certified Specialist in Psychometry (CSP)
